Besides light, temperature and oxygen, water is the most
important factor for the germination process of grass plants.
Water is not
only involved in the basic processes but is also the elixir of life. Without
water there would be no germination,
no growth and therefore no green areas.
With this in mind isn’t it better to supply the seedling from the outset with
water
and the nutrients it requires? With the development of WASP this idea
of optimizing the water around the seedling at a very
early stage has been
realized through the absorber coating.
From the coating of nutrients and absorber, coated WASP seed
absorbs more humidity than naked seeds,
this is now available to the young
seedling through the coating.
This is due primarily to the super-absorber in
the coating which serves as a water reservoir.
Water is stored in the coat
and is available to the seedling as required. Besides raised water
receptiveness,
an increased nutrient uptake is also guaranteed to the
seedling.

It comes to the first and most important step of the germination
process: the swelling.
The seed releases reserved nutrients and enzymes are
activated.
The seminal bowl (testa) bursts and the germ root (radicle)
develops.
The young seedling starts to grow. From this time the young plant
begins the process of photosynthesis and takes up
nutrients from the
coating.

WASP also grows under extreme conditions. (Trial
results)
Within a greenhouse, WASP as well as traditional naked
seeds were sown in quartz sand.
Through a series of experiments the
seeds were put through extreme climatic conditions like water stress,
high temperatures and strong rays of the sun. The aim was to observe in
particular the growth behaviour after germination.
From the 9th day the
growth increase of both seeds were determined. The naked seed could not stand up
to or overcome
the extreme climatic conditions, they dried up and died. WASP
was able to store the small quantity of humidity better and
stood firm to
the extreme conditions.

Water in the coat
The new seed-technology
allows us now for the first time to bind water close to every single seed and
prevents the germinated seeds from drying out.
The absorbent quality
of the coat is increased by the water tank around the seedling and
prevents
the germinated seeds from drying up. The seeds are surrounded
by a type of sponge, which supplies
the seedling with the water and
nutrients contained in the coat. The nutrient coat is preserved until
the
lawn has established and formed a thick sward.
Machine or manual sowing is substantially simplified by the higher
1000grm grain weight of the WASP
seed in comparison to traditional naked
seeds.
Blasts of wind do not destroy the sowing pattern: the seeds remain
controlled in their distribution
to the sowing surface.
The seed soil
contact is improved by the increased weight of the seed and the grass sward is
thicker
and better rooted.
This excellent WASP Start Up care can
increase the germination of the seeds compared with traditional
naked seeds
by up to 50%.
The actual coating protects the seed even before we
consider the content of the coating. In addition
the slight red colouring
makes it much easier to control the seeding rate and sowing density visually.
The nutrients contained in the coating are supplied to the seedling during
its initial development after
germination. The coating consists of purely
mineral and biological components which are safe for the
soil and ground
water. Nevertheless, birds avoid the coated seeds so when it comes to sowing
time
the seeds are not lost to birds. All the components of the coating are
in tune with each other and are
especially suited to the seed.
